Trip Overview

Spanning 202.5 miles between Susanville and Laguna, this journey takes approximately 4 hours and 21 minutes to complete. Because the route remains entirely within California’s Pacific Coast region, it is easily manageable as a single-day trip. You should budget roughly $47 for fuel to cover the distance. Navigating via CA 32, CA 70, and Hillcrest Road, you will find a consistent, highway-focused path that keeps you moving efficiently. While you could extend your travel time by lingering at stops, the direct nature of this drive makes it an ideal option for travelers looking to reach their destination without the need for an overnight stay.

Drive Character

Expect a drive that is heavily weighted toward highway travel, with 74% of the journey spent on major thoroughfares. The road’s personality shifts as you progress, offering a mix of transit styles that keeps the experience from feeling like a monotonous grind. You will encounter a longest uninterrupted stretch of 52.4 miles while navigating CA 32, which serves as a significant portion of your time behind the wheel. The transition between these specific highway segments requires steady attention, providing a balanced feel that is neither purely rural nor strictly urban. Overall, the infrastructure supports a smooth, predictable rhythm for the duration of your trip.

Most of the miles stay on highways, which makes pacing and fuel planning easier than turn-by-turn city driving.
There are about 35 navigation steps in the underlying route data, so the final approach matters more than the middle miles.
CA 32 is the longest continuous segment at about 52.4 miles.
